Official record
Development description
- Permission for partial demolition of existing flat roof garage to the side of existing detached house and construction of
- New single storey extension to the side with flat parapet roof
- New steps to the side of existing garage to access new house entrance
- Roof lights in new flat roof
- Internal alterations and associated site and drainage works
